Finding Efficiencies and Saving Money by Re-evaluating Your Transportation System

Vigo County School Corporation (VCSC) in Terre Haute, Indiana consists of eighteen elementary schools, five middle schools, three high schools, two alternative schools, and a number of schools and programs that serve special needs students. VCSC maintains student transportation within the District, and serves approximately 14,000 students and their families with 141 school bus routes, covering 267 square miles.

In May 2019, VCSC engaged First Solutions to complete an Independent Audit for Transportation. VCSC wanted a partner who could assess how well the transportation department was currently utilizing their electronic routing software, review their current routing model to find efficiencies and cost savings, model bell time scenario options, and provide advice on whether or not to keep the facilities and transportation functions in one department or split them into two separate departments.
